Trilogy Center for Women has been providing recovery treatment to people who reside in Bremen, Kentucky and who are battling with alcohol and drug use issues. As such, Trilogy Center for Women provides a array of services including anger management, individual psychotherapy, trauma therapy, contingency management/motivational incentive, vocational rehabilitation services, cognitive/behavior therapy and others using its unique approaches to addiction recovery and treatment.
This rehab also thinks that each client benefits most from individualized services. Because of this, it has been specializing in a wide variety of personalized treatments like suicide prevention services, treatment for spanish-speaking clients, self-help groups, transgender or (LGBT) clients, child care for clients children, residential beds for client's children and more. In the same way, this addiction treatment program provides these treatments in the following settings - inpatient detoxification facilities, outpatient individual counseling, inpatient rehab programs, long term drug rehab programs, short term drug and alcohol rehab programs and more.
It also has aftercare programs designed to replicate its treatment methods in the creation of a level of stability, abstinence, and sobriety that is permanent and lasting. Lastly, Trilogy Center for Women accepts these payment forms - including private insurance, private pay, military insurance, sliding fee scale, access to recovery (atr) voucher, other state funds and others.
